 .DISCUSSION...
 Rounds of showers and thunderstorms are expected throughout the rest 
 of the work week and the weekend as a humid summertime air mass 
 remains in place across the region. Localized flash flooding remains 
 a possibility, especially on Friday and Saturday when storms become 
 more widespread. Near seasonable temperatures are expected through 
 the weekend, with dense fog in some areas during the overnight and 
 early morning hours.
